Affirming trauma therapy with a queer trauma therapist in Chicago
My approach blends modalities that support whole-person healing. These include Internal Family Systems (IFS), Feminist Therapy, Queer Theory, Liberation Psychology, somatic awareness, and creative expression. Furthermore, I strive to meet clients where they are. I adapt our work to honor your lived experiences, intersecting identities, and evolving needs.
As a queer and non-binary therapist, I’m especially passionate about supporting LGBTQIA+ clients as they navigate identity, relationships, and mental health. In addition, I specialize in working with survivors of sexual and relationship violence. I have extensive experience in trauma advocacy and sex education. As an LGBTQ trauma therapist in Chicago, I am committed to creating spaces that center your safety, empowerment, and agency.
Queer trauma therapist in Chicago supporting healing and growth
I earned my BA in Political Science from Stanford University and my MA in Clinical Mental Health Counseling from Northwestern University. In addition, I’m a certified domestic and sexual violence counselor. I currently facilitate the Survivors Reclaiming Self Group. I also co-facilitate Queering Connection and From Self-Criticism to Self-Compassion therapy groups.
